JVC's GZ-MG330 Everio Hybrid Camcorder (Silver) brings together elegant design and the convenience of hybrid recording. While its compact size allows you take this camcorder virtually anywhere you go, its sleek color adds style. The 1/6" CCD sensor provides high quality video and stills every time you shoot while the Gigabrid Engine enhances each shot. And, let's not forget the 30GB hard disk drive that provides up to 37.5 hours of recording time. You can also record your extra video footage and still images to MicroSD cards, should you need more space.

If you weren't already impressed with JVC's GZ-MG330H, consider that it also features Laser Touch Navigation, a system that lets you scroll along the side of the LCD screen, instead of on it, for menus and browsing through video clips. This camcorder also boasts 35x optical zoom, Quick Restart, a Konica Minolta lens and Direct DVD and Direct Backup buttons among other great features. 30GB Hard Disk Drive
The 30GB HDD holds up to 37.5 hours of footage in ECO mode and just over 7 hours in ULTRA FINE mode. Forget about the days of carrying around extra tapes or DVDs, with this much recording space no matter how long you record the GZ-MG330H will be able to keep up.
Micro SD Card Slot
Record your still images or extra video footage to microSD cards for easy transfer to your PC for emailing, printing or sharing on sites like YouTube. Micro SD cards can also be used with PictBridge compatible devices for fast and easy printing.
1/6" CCD Image Sensor
The 1/6" CCD image sensor in the GZ-MG330H captures stunning footage each and every time you shoot.
Laser Touch Navigation
JVC's Laser Touch Navigation is much like the touch screen menu navigation systems seen on other brands of camcorders, except that there's no need to touch your LCD screen - preventing it from being smudged or damaged. Simply run your finger along the illuminated scroll bar to the left of the LCD screen to browse and select video clips and to operate menus for setting up the GZ-MG330H.

35x Optical Zoom
The 35x optical zoom brings your subjects in close and clear with no loss in image quality.
Gigabrid Engine
JVC's Gigabrid Engine works to provide you with the best image possible from the 1/6" CCD image sensor by using a progressive scan to gather the most information from your footage. Five digital noise reduction technologies also work together to improve the vertical resolution of the GZ-MG330H over previous standard definition camcorders made by JVC.
Direct DVD/Direct Backup Button
With the touch of a button, you can burn your footage to DVD (using a connected DVD burner) with the Direct DVD button. In similar fashion, the Direct Backup Button allows you to back up your video to your PC with just the touch of a button.
Windows Software
The GZ-MG330H comes with CyberLink DVD Solution and Digital Photo Navigator software for Windows operating systems.
Quick Restart
When you open the LCD screen on your GZ-MG330H the camera is ready to record in less than a second, ensuring that you never miss the perfect moment again.

Optics
Sensor 1/6" CCD sensor (680k pixels)
Lens Konica Minolta lens
Focal Length=2.2-77mm
f/stop:1.8-4.0
Zoom 35x Optical
800x Digital
Filter Size 30.5mm
Recording
System NTSC
Format MPEG-2
Audio Dolby Digital AC3
Image Stabilization Digital Image Stabilization
Lux Not specified by manufacturer
Recording Media 30GB Hard disk drive
MicroSD memory card
Recording Time 30GB HDD
Ultra Fine: 430 minutes, Economy: 2250 minutes

MicroSD Card
4GB: Ultra Fine: 57 minutes, Economy: 298 minutes

Display
Display Type Widescreen clear LCD
Display Size 2.7"
Viewfinder No
Camera Features
Manual Controls Focus
White Balance
Built-in Speaker Yes
Built-in Mic Yes
Accessory Shoe No
Built-in Light/Flash Yes - video light
No - flash
Digital Still Mode
Still Recording Media 30GB HDD
MicroSD cards
Resolution 640 x 480
Input/Output Connectors
Inputs None
Output USB (mini type A & type B)
USB 2.0 compliant
A/V out
Microphone Input No
Headphone Jack No
General
Languages English, French, Spanish, Portuguese, Japanese, Korean, Traditional Chinese
Compatible Operating Systems Windows XP Home (SP2), XP Professional (SP2), Vista (Home Basic & Home Premium)
Power Requirements 110-240VAC, 50/60Hz
Dimensions (WxHxD) 2 3/16 x 2 11/16 x 4 1/2" (54 x 68 x 113mm)
Weight 0.80 lbs (360g)

[...]I bought this camera because I am a powerlifter and 1. wanted to record my lifts, to see if my form needed improvement; 2. to make training videos (using IMovie) for fun and personal use.So, I needed a camera that works with Apple's Imovie and/or Final Cut (should I decide to upgrade to the latter). It was very confusing to find such a camera, but I found a link to an Apple site that lists exactly what cameras they tested that works with their system. This camera was on that list, and I did more research and bought it.For my needs, this camera could not be any better. There's 30 GB of memory and a slot of a SD card, so even more Gigs can be added. I've already recorded about 2 hours of stuff and haven't even come close to using 1 GB. So I doubt I'll have memory needs.However, one who uses the camera more often (perhaps only those on a daily basis) might have problems. For those spending a week's vacation, you could record every moment you want, I'd imagine.As for the battery, I did not want to be changing batteries in the middle of a workout, so I bought the highest powered battery (something-23, as opposed to the something-08 that came with the camera), and with that battery, I can have the camera running and recording every now and then during a 4 hour session and still have nearly full power. I cannot attest to the standard battery because I did not use it.As per size, this camera is the same size as my Iphone. Seriously, it is small, which may be good or bad to different people. As a plus, it easily fits in a purse or bag and can be whipped out in a flash. As a minus, it can fall in between the cushions of the couch. While I said a con is "flimsy construction," I haven't experienced any problems with it (as in breaking, chipping) but I mention that as a potential concern because of its small size. But, I have had no problems with it.One thing - this is NOT a high-definition camera, but it's video quality is much better than my 5 year old tape camera that it replaced. I wasn't looking for high definition anyway.One final caveat - in some lights, the camera may have a picture quality with a red tint. In my living room, there's a chandelier (I don't know what kind of bulbs we use) and the camera has a moderate red tint to anything that is recorded in that room. But, every other room in my house is normal colors, which includes rooms with fluorescent lights. I have yet to record anything outside. In my gym, a public place, I couldn't be happier with the picture quality.Overall, a wonderful camera that suits me perfectly.

I picked this up to add another camera to a live music shoot that I was filming. It's small size and large storage capacity combined with a ridiculously low clearance price made it a sure sale.

Unfortunately, this camera could not handle the sound waves from the amps and PA speakers and would hard drive fail continually. In the end, what little footage I could salvage was so intermittent that it proved utterly pointless to use.

Now, at times it would have a hard time adjusting to low light, with either poor exposure or focusing trouble, but it did produce solid video.

The color rendition in low light seems to be very warm and unsaturated, but the video itself looks sharp.

My recommendation would be to grab one of these for home videos or daylight shooting. Definitely DO NOT buy one of these for shooting live music or any situation that is in a loud enviroment.

      This little camera offers so much for so little. I was mainly interested in a camcorder to record my art demonstrations. The 30GB hard drive allows me to record an entire lesson without downloading. With the AV function I can view as I work on my TV and with the little remote control I can zoom in and out with out going to the camera on the tripod. I use the AC adapter so the so-so average battery life is not a concern. The only disappointment is the output is not a true Mpeg 4 as stated. It's a .MOD and I have to use their software then convert to an AVI to use with the software I prefer. B&H beat everyone's price [...] Great company neat camcorder!I'm a happy teacher and customer!

        I have owned this camcorder for about a year now. It is a good camcorder for standard every day use. The resolution is average, not HD video quality by any means. This was an impulse by for me when [...] had them on sale for $380. I would recomend this camcorder to the average user, especially for [$]. If i had it to do over again i would have purchased an HD camcorder. The only gripe i have about this camcorder is that it records in .mod instead of .mpg, which is not compatable with many media players. Also it's too small for a person with large hands and the battery life could be better.
